News summary

With Election Day on Nov. 4, 2025, numerous local contests nationwide are drawing attention, from city council and mayoral races to municipal judge elections. In Albuquerque’s District 9, incumbent Renee Grout and challenger Colton Newman clash over crime and homelessness—Grout credits ordinances and close police cooperation for drops in catalytic-converter thefts while Newman emphasizes supportive services like the Gateway Center and proactive response teams. Other contested races include Toledo’s mayoral contest between incumbent Wade Kapszukiewicz and challenger Roberto Torres (with Harold Harris running as a write-in), a three-way race for Aurora’s Ward I council seat, Cincinnati council candidate Seth Walsh, and multiple candidates vying for Canton municipal court seats. In Massachusetts, Chicopee’s Ward 8 will seat unopposed Douglas Girouard, with at-large hopeful Clark Wojtowicz campaigning against tax increases, and Nashua alderman-at-large candidates debated affordable housing and proposals such as the Elm Street redevelopment. At the state and federal level, Ballotpedia reported nine legislatures considered 27 election-administration bills this week—including Louisiana changes to 2026 election dates—and a federal appeals court upheld redrawn Tarrant County commissioner districts, underscoring broader election-policy activity ahead of local voting.
